Stylish Extended Bungalow on Generous Corner Plot Ready to Move Into
This beautifully presented and significantly extended semi-detached bungalow offers stylish, spacious living in a peaceful residential setting. Thoughtfully remodelled to create a flowing layout and enhanced by a striking kitchen extension, the property is ready for immediate occupation.
The accommodation begins with a welcoming entrance hall leading into a spacious lounge, complete with a bow window and feature fireplace, creating a warm and inviting atmosphere. An inner hallway with a useful built-in storage cupboard provides access to all main rooms.
The master bedroom is a generous double with fitted wardrobes, while the second bedroom is a spacious single, also featuring fitted robes and French patio doors opening onto the side garden. A standout feature of this home is the stunning open-plan dining area, which flows seamlessly into the kitchen extension. The kitchen itself is finished with sleek high-gloss units, integrated appliances, and an atrium-style skylight that floods the space with natural light. Patio doors open directly to the rear garden, perfect for indoor-outdoor living.
Externally, the property occupies a generous corner plot with beautifully landscaped, low-maintenance gardens including paved and gravelled patio seating areas—ideal for outdoor entertaining or relaxing during the summer months.
Location - Brancepeth View is a modern and well-planned development on the edge of Brandon, conveniently located close to Langley Moor and Meadowfield, which offer a selection of local shops and amenities. Durham City Centre is just four miles away, providing a wider range of shopping, dining, and leisure options. The property also offers excellent transport links, with nearby access to the A690 and A167 for easy commuting to surrounding regional centres.
